Formula for the Future

We are currently designing a 425,000 square foot, 192-bed acute care expansion including surgery, imaging, clinical ancillary services, a pharmacy, support and general services. The design maximizes the use of natural light and all elements are scaled to be child-friendly. The hospital is pursuing a LEED platinum rating. The expansion includes 128,000 square feet of renovation, a 56,000 square-foot medical office building, and a 1,000 car underground parking garage. The highest ranked children’s hospital in California is also ranked in the top 10 nationally by US News and World Report. With one of the best teams of pediatric specialists in the world, Packard and Stanford are vital to training the next generation of pediatric leaders and developing new treatments for childhood diseases.

On May 2, 2007, the Lucile Packard Foundation for Children’s Health launched an exciting initiative. Breaking New Ground, a five-year, $300 million campaign, will raise critical funding to address the opportunities and needs facing Packard Children’s and the community, including plans for a major expansion of the hospital to better serve children who need its care.
